Output d65303d9aa691c57d1f2d563a28e99cb6f3ade34bac2ae9af97190db57faf609:17

value
112636538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17da2c68ad4eebabb67e4cfa74d2249be7362f8a OP_EQUALVERIFY OP_CHECKSIG
address
13B7uNW472gBv1k3RH97VZapgRkeeFDxX6
transaction
d65303d9aa691c57d1f2d563a28e99cb6f3ade34bac2ae9af97190db57faf609
confirmations
613857
spent
true